Essential Tools and Equipment for Concrete Burnishing

Achieving a smooth, durable concrete finish requires the right tools and equipment. Some key essentials include a burnisher, which can be gas-powered depending on your project's scale. To achieve optimal results, you'll also need concrete floats of various sizes for initial leveling and smoothing. Moreover, a vibrator helps eliminate air pockets and ensure a dense concrete surface. Additional valuable tools include brushes, edgers, and diamond plates for refining the finish.

Elements Affecting the Effectiveness of Concrete Burnishing

The success of concrete burnishing is shaped by a variety of elements. Surface preparation plays a essential role, as a uniform surface enables for more optimal burnishing. The variety of concrete used also matters, with denser concretes being prone to achieve a smoother finish. The expertise of the operator is another crucial factor, as proper burnishing practices are essential to achieve the desired results. Environmental circumstances, such as temperature and humidity, can also impact the drying process of concrete, which in turn can affect the burnishing finish.

Common Issues in Concrete Burnishing

Burnishing concrete can frequently present certain challenges. A primary issue is uneven surface compaction. This can arise from poor roller pressure or technique. Another typical issue is skin imperfections, which can be originate from debris in the concrete mix or subpar curing. Resolving these issues requires careful attention to detail and adherence to best practices throughout the burnishing process.
